The time-reversal (TR) technique is universally acknowledged as dominant roles in acoustic applications. In this paper, implementation schemes for multi-source TR focusing on airborne sound were systematically investigated. An improved version of the traditional scheme was introduced according to the principle of reciprocity. Variations in multi-source TR focusing based on the improved focusing scheme were proposed, which included the multi-group focusing method and the signal superposition method. Furthermore, the traditional focusing scheme was extended to verify the adaptability of multi-source focusing experimentally. The performance and realization complexity of the three variations were discussed to identify the best scheme. This work extended the TR method from a single source to multi-source situations via the superposition method, which is superior to existing techniques and simplifies the scenarios of multi-source focusing, therefore, promoting acoustic focusing research and application. |
